All versions require an EA account.
To use the online multiplayer mode, only one player needs to own the game. The other can download the Friend's Pass. Remote Play Together is also possible on Steam.

Essential improvements

Skip intro video

Delete video files[1]
  1. Go to <path-to-game>\Nuts\Content\Movies\.
  2. Delete, rename or move the splash_itt_*.mp4 file that matches your game's resolution and framerate.

Game data

Configuration file(s) location

System Location
Windows %LOCALAPPDATA%\ItTakesTwo\Saved\Config\WindowsNoEditor\
Steam Play (Linux) <Steam-folder>/steamapps/compatdata/1426210/pfx/[Note 1]

Save game data location

System Location
Windows %LOCALAPPDATA%\ItTakesTwo\
Steam Play (Linux) <Steam-folder>/steamapps/compatdata/1426210/pfx/[Note 1]
